Design of biorthogonal filter banks composed of linear phase IIR filters

1998 
Since IIR filters have lower computational complexity than FIR filters, some design methods for IIR filter banks have been presented in the recent literature. Smith et al. (1990) have proposed a class of linear phase IIR filter banks. However this method restricts the order of the numerator to be odd and, moreover, has some drawbacks. In this paper we present two design methods for linear phase IIR filter banks. One is based on Lagrange-Multiplier method, in which optimal IIR filter banks in least squares sense are obtained. In the other approach, IIR filter banks with the maximum number of zeros are derived analytically.
